Eligibility Criteria for CAT Entrance Exam
To be qualified for the CAT entrance examination, trainees must fulfill certain requirements:
- Age: There is no age limit for appearing in the CAT entrance test.
- Educational Qualification: Students must have a bachelor's degree from a recognized university, with a minimum of 50% marks.
- Reservation: The CAT entrance examination offers booking for students from SC/ST/PwD classifications.

CAT Entrance Exam Pattern
The CAT entrance examination consists of three areas:
-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ension (VARC): This section tests trainees' verbal capability and reading comprehension abilities.
- Information Interpretation and Logical Reasoning (DILR): This area tests students' information interpretation and sensible reasoning skills.
- Quantitative Ability (QA): This area tests students' quantitative capability and mathematical skills.
